The City of Agency offers a wide range of events, from seasonal Events which include City Wide Garage Sales-Both Spring & Fall, July 3rd & 4th Celebrations with our own City Fireworks Display ( 4th of July Parade, Family Fun Activities at the Park), City Easter Egg Hunt at the Park, Santa comes to town in December at the Agency Fire Station,  to spending time in our local parks, and relaxing with your family for an afternoon of outdoor fun.  There are lots of activities to choose from.

Chief Wapello Memorial Park

6899 Chief Wapello Road-Agency IA  52530

The Park is located Southeast of Agency Iowa at the site of the 1842 Treaty that ceded the last of theSaul and Fox Tribes' Iowa holdings to the US Government. The Site includes the Grave of Chief Wapello and Indian Agency Joseph Street as well as members of the Street Family.  There was a Memorial erected in 1946 by the "Daughters of the American Revolution" marking the site of the Agency House built by Street and a memorial donated by the First Methodisst Church of Agency to commemorate the 1838 first Christian Service in interior Iowa as well as a display of Historic Information.  The Park was added to the National Park Service's National Registry of Historic Places in 1975.  It is maintained by volunteers of the Chief Wapello Memorial Park Association.  Hleping hands are welcome.
